Mercedes concerned by marginal cooling ahead of potentially hot Austrian GP

Mercedes boss Toto Wolff says the team’s “marginal” situation regarding engine cooling acts as a concern for this weekend’s Austrian Grand Prix. The full-throttle sections at the Red Bull Ring are expected to play to the strengths of Ferrari, which has held a straight-line speed advantage in 2019. Western and Central Europe is also currently in the midst of a heatwave, with temperatures set to potentially exceed 30˚C this weekend in Austria. “I think when you look at Ferrari’s strengths this year [it] is power, and we are not able to match them this year,” said Wolff. “Up the hills that can certainly be to their advantage, and on the cooling...
